Management Consulting: From Slide Decks to Superpowers

Management consultants live and die by data, deadlines, and deliverables. AI’s turning that grind into gold. Tools like Grok 3 analyze markets, predict trends, and churn out client-ready presentations in hours, not weeks. A McKinsey report says firms using AI cut project timelines by 30%.

Let’s imagine a junior consultant (we’ll call her Sarah), at a bulge bracket consulting firm. She used to spend nights crunching numbers for a retail client’s expansion plan. Now? Her AI tool scans global sales data, flags risks, and drafts a killer strategy — while she’s at happy hour. If utilized properly, AI is like having a team of interns who never sleep. The outcome? Sarah is now free to focus on what clients really pay for: big-picture thinking and relationship-building. AI handles the grunt work; she brings the vision.

Healthcare: Precision Meets Compassion

Doctors are swamped — charts, diagnoses, endless paperwork. AI’s stepping in like a super-smart assistant. Tools like IBM Watson analyze patient data, spot patterns, and suggest treatments faster than any human. A Harvard study found AI-assisted doctors caught 15% more early-stage cancers in 2024.

Dr. Patel, a Chicago oncologist, uses AI to cross-reference patient symptoms with global research in seconds. “It’s not replacing me,” he says. “It’s giving me time to actually talk to my patients.” That human touch — empathy, trust — pairs with AI’s precision to save lives. On X, doctors rave about AI cutting their admin time, letting them focus on care over keyboards.

Why AI’s Your Edge

Here’s the deal: AI isn’t about replacing you; it’s about amplifying you. It’s like a jetpack for your career, giving you speed and reach you didn’t have before. Here’s why it’s a game-changer:

  • Speed: Tasks that took days now take hours. Consultants deliver faster; doctors diagnose quicker; creatives iterate without breaking a sweat.
  • Accuracy: AI’s data-crunching catches details humans miss — like a market trend or a medical red flag.
  • Freedom: Less time on grunt work means more time for strategy, empathy, or big ideas.

But there’s a catch. AI’s only as good as the human using it. A Gartner report says 80% of execs want workers skilled in AI tools by 2026. The fact of the matter is if (as a professional) you don’t know how to prompt a model or interpret its output, you’re falling dangerously behind.

The Haters and the Hurdles

Not everyone’s sold. X is buzzing with skeptics calling AI a “job-stealer” or “soulless tech.” Some consultants worry clients won’t pay premium rates for AI-generated work. Others fear over-reliance — AI’s great, but it can churn out nonsense if you don’t steer it right. A viral thread last week roasted a firm for sending an AI-drafted report full of jargon but no substance. “Garbage in, garbage out,” one user quipped.

There’s also the learning curve. Mastering AI takes time, and not everyone’s got the bandwidth to retrain. But here’s the truth: those who adapt are already outpacing the laggards. Companies like Deloitte are mandating AI training, and freelancers who embrace it are landing bigger gigs.
